Next work your slab into a ball and knead it to make it soft.
Thumb of 2011-07-18/Robynznest/4f4ef0

Roll out to about 1/4" thick, like you are making a pie crust. Put your template on top of it and cut, I use a cheap paring knife.
Thumb of 2011-07-18/Robynznest/33760b

Thumb of 2011-07-18/Robynznest/ec8d13

With the leftovers, roll out again for your next door
Thumb of 2011-07-18/Robynznest/03478f

With these leftovers I make the hinges and door knobs.
